Journal: iScience
Article Title: Integration of GWAS and eQTL analysis reveals regulatory CNVs for fatty acid traits in cattle
doi: 10.1016/j.isci.2026.116180
Figure Lengend Snippet: Results of functional validation experiments on target genes AGPAT3 and ECHDC3 in adipocytes (A) qPCR results of expression levels of 16 lipid metabolism-related genes. mRNA expression of the target genes was significantly knocked down by approximately 90% in all three transfection groups. The expression of FABP4 , FASN , ADIPOR1 , and CEBPα was significantly elevated in the si- AGPAT3 group, especially FABP4 and ADIPOR1 (∗ p < 0.05 by Student’s t test). (B) Comparison results of the triglyceride content between the two target gene knockdown groups and the control group. Triglyceride quantification revealed that triglyceride levels were significantly higher in all three knockdown groups than in the control group (∗ p < 0.05 by Dunnett’s test). (C–F) Comparison results of four fatty acids content (C18:0, C18:2, C22:0, and C22:6) between the two target gene knockdown groups and the control group. Fatty acid profiling showed that both AGPAT3 and ECHDC3 knockdown significantly suppressed the accumulation of most fatty acids, including C18:0, C18:2, and C22:6 (∗ p < 0.05 by Dunnett’s test). Four groups were included: si-NC (negative control, white), si- AGPAT3 (red), si- ECHDC3 (green), and si-A3+si-E3 (double knockdown, blue) ( n = 3 technical replicates from 4 biological replicates for each transfection group). Data are represented as the mean ± SEM.
